ontario | I'd grind or roll it. Cattle on full grain finishing ration will do ok on whole grain but too much passes through. If corn is cheap you can accept poorer feed conversion ,but at feed prices like right now you want to maximize every pound they eat. Also cattle will 'get tired' of whole corn around 100 days on feed. Conversions are terrible after that. The fine ground corn the dairy guys use is useful when you feed a high roughage diet. The higher grain /low roughage finishing rations should be course ground ,rolled or best of all steam flaked. My thoughts. | |
